The PGA Tour opens this weekend in the Quad Cities with the annual Fourth of July John Deere Classic, with Brian Campbell as the defending champion.

Similar to last week’s host course, TPC River Highlands, TPC Deer Run will give players plenty of scoring chances, and there’s a good chance someone will make another run in the sub-60 round. While Deere doesn’t have the game’s elite stars on the field, there are still some notable names. The most intriguing player in this area is Jackson Koibun. He will be making his professional debut after ending his stellar amateur career by tying for the Raw Am title at the US Open two weeks ago.

In addition to Koibun’s pro debut, Jordan Spieth, Rickie Fowler, Max Homa and Chris Gotterup will all also make the trip to the Quad-Cities to try to find some form for the end of the 2026 season. To win the Leaping Deer trophy, someone must make a string of birdies to conquer the Deer Run field.

2026 John Deere Classic TV Schedule

always east

Round 1 – Thursday

Round 1 begins: 7:45am (tea time)

PGA Tour Live: 7:45am – 7:00pm — PGA Tour Live

Live TV: on Golf Channel from 4 to 7 p.m.
Live streaming: On GolfChannel.com from 4 to 7 p.m.

wireless: 1:00 p.m. to 7:00 p.m. — PGA Tour Radio

Round 2 – Friday

Round 2 begins: 7:45am (tea time)

PGA Tour Live: 7:45am – 7:00pm — PGA Tour Live

Live TV: on Golf Channel from 4 to 7 p.m.
Live streaming: On GolfChannel.com from 4 to 7 p.m.

wireless: 1:00 p.m. to 7:00 p.m. — PGA Tour Radio

Round 3 – Saturday

Round 3 begins: 7:45am (tea time)

PGA Tour Live: 7:45am – 6pm — PGA Tour Live

Early TV coverage: 1-3 p.m. on Golf Channel
Early streaming: On GolfChannel.com from 1-3 p.m.

Live TV: 3-6 p.m. on CBS, Paramount+
Live streaming: From 3pm to 6pm on CBSSports.com and the CBS Sports App.

wireless: 1:00 p.m. to 6:00 p.m. — PGA Tour Radio

Round 4 – Sunday

Round 4 begins: 7:45am (tea time)

PGA Tour Live: 7:45am – 6pm — PGA Tour Live

Early TV coverage: 1-3 p.m. on Golf Channel
Early streaming: On GolfChannel.com from 1-3 p.m.

Live TV: 3-6 p.m. on CBS, Paramount+
Live streaming: From 3:00pm to 6:00pm on CBSSports.com and the CBS Sports App

wireless: 1:00 p.m. to 6:00 p.m. — PGA Tour Radio
